Rory Clifton-Parks's Story
Rory Clifton-Parks's Story
"Growing up in the beachside suburbs of Perth's North Beach, Trigg and Scarborough, I developed an early love of the salt, sand and sun that my coastal surroundings enveloped me in. With aspirations to start my own landscape gardening business, I completed TAFE certificates in
Horticulture and Small Business upon graduating from high school.
It was through taking time out after completing my studies to embark on a working holiday in the South West where I retreated to nature and found myself camping at Yallingup and working in a vineyard for the first time.
After absorbing these new surroundings - which offered a beautiful balance of beach and bush - I came to realise that the South West offered the perfect lifestyle and this inspired me to commence studying Viticulture at Curtin University so I could one day return and settle in the region.
An enthusiastic interest in the science of winemaking saw me complete my Oenology degree and in 2006 I visited Sonoma in California where I worked for a small family-owned and operated winery. Besides making and drinking extremely good wine I surfed northern California on my time off and managed to sneak in a surf trip to Mexico!
Upon returning to WA, and just as planned, my chosen career path enabled me to relocate to the south and between 2007-2011 I worked as a winemaker for Evans and Tate and Boar's Rock.
Having recently commenced winemaking for Franklin Tate Estates, I strive to make high quality wines which reflect the Terrior of the region. With some of the best facilities Margaret River has to offer at my disposal, I get great satisfaction from seeing fruit processed through to the final bottled product.
It may come as no surprise that my palate is biased towards Margaret River varietals and styles and I can often be found indulging in a well deserved glass or two of Chardonnay, Shiraz or Cabernet Sauvignon after a long day at the vineyard.
Spending my time immersed in a natural environment and surfing the enviable breaks of the Margaret River coastline, my passion for my region is surpassed only by my passion to bottle the beauty of Margaret River and share it with the rest of the world."
